ABSTRACT BAL0030543, BAL0030544, and BAL0030545 are dihydrophthalazine inhibitors with in vitro potency against gram-positive pathogens. The MIC50s for methicillin (meticillin)-sensitive Staphylococcus aureus, methicillin-resistant Staphylococcus aureus, hetero-vancomycin-resistant Staphylococcus aureus, and vancomycin-resistant Staphylococcus aureus (VISA) range from 0.015 to 0.25 μg/ml (MIC90s ≤ 0.5 μg/ml). MIC50s for beta-hemolytic streptococci range from 0.03 to 0.06 μg/ml, MIC50s for Streptococcus pneumoniae range from 0.06 to 0.12 μg/ml, MIC50s for Listeria monocytogenes range from 0.015 to 0.06 μg/ml, and MIC50s for Streptococcus mitis are ≤0.015 μg/ml. These three dihydrophthalazine antifolates have improved potency compared to that of trimethoprim and activity against gram-positive pathogens resistant to other drug classes.
